About

Gan Li is a scholar working on Electrical and Electronic Engineering, Automotive Engineering and Mechanics of Materials. According to data from OpenAlex, Gan Li has authored 3 papers receiving a total of 359 indexed citations (citations by other indexed papers that have themselves been cited), including 2 papers in Electrical and Electronic Engineering, 1 paper in Automotive Engineering and 1 paper in Mechanics of Materials. Recurrent topics in Gan Li's work include Ocular and Laser Science Research (1 paper), Space Satellite Systems and Control (1 paper) and Laser-induced spectroscopy and plasma (1 paper). Gan Li is often cited by papers focused on Ocular and Laser Science Research (1 paper), Space Satellite Systems and Control (1 paper) and Laser-induced spectroscopy and plasma (1 paper). Gan Li collaborates with scholars based in China and United Kingdom. Gan Li's co-authors include Xiaoping Zhang and has published in prestigious journals such as IEEE Transactions on Smart Grid and Proceedings of the Institution of Mechanical Engineers Part G Journal of Aerospace Engineering.
